Understanding Forex Robots
A forex robot represents an algorithmic tool analyzing currency data and generates alerts for trading for currency pairs based on set methodologies.
It independently evaluates price trajectories, technical indicators, or analytical frameworks to determine entry points, position sizes, and exits. By eliminating emotional influences, it aims for trading with impartiality and regularity.
These robots seamlessly connect with brokers’ platforms to transmit orders without human facilitation. Frequently termed trading bots or expert advisors, they function using rules coded from analytical criteria, news trading, or microstructural insights when suitably programmed.
While they operate around the clock across time zones, observation remains important since unexpected events might affect market conditions beyond predictions.
How Forex Robots Work
Forex robots perform their functions by consistently scanning real-time market data and applying predefined trading strategies to determine potential trade openings. They utilize technical analysis, including moving averages and RSI, to assess market trajectories and formations.
You can set up these robots to engage in automatic trading or only alert you for your action. They are often employed with MetaTrader platforms (MT4 and MT5) and equipped to handle multiple conditions like entry conditions and stop-loss orders in parallel.
For example, a robot might automatically establish buy or sell requests based on specific price formations if requirements are met.

Integration With Trading Platforms
Integration with broker systems affects how effectively your forex robot can perform automated trades and correspond to market data.
Well-known systems like MetaTrader 4 (MT4) and MetaTrader 5 (MT5) accommodate trading bots by providing Integrated Development Environments (IDEs) like MQL4 and MQL5 for coding, testing, and deploying Expert Advisors (EAs) or bots.
These platforms render services for your robot to process actual market data, undertake automatic ordering, and control risk facets according to precodified logic.
Synchronizing compatibility with the trading platform guarantees seamless interaction for order execution, market analysis, and strategic refines.
Furthermore, installing VPS networks on your preferred operating system and running the corresponding platform ensures the robot operates uninterruptedly and stability in communication, critical for persistent performance if your network link is unstable.
Setting Up and Customizing Forex Robots
Setting up and customizing a forex mechanism encompasses a sequence of steps to verify efficient operation.
You must specify your trading strategy, detailing entry-exit markers, risk parameters, and trading frequency.
Suites such as MetaTrader, EA Studio, or Capitalise.ai enable robot design using coding languages like MQL4 or MQL5, or with visual interfaces for no-code solutions.
Backtesting with past data is vital for proving effectiveness.
Define loss containment and profit-taking parameters, such as between 10 and 100 pips, and enforce criteria like a floor of 200 trades for robust checks.
If using interfaces, ensure your EA suits coupling with MQL5.
Advantages and Challenges of Trading Automation
Forex robots enable continuous monitoring, and conduct transactions devoid of emotional bias, enabling capture of opportunities nonstop, five days a week.
They offer several advantages, such as improved trade effectiveness, accelerated decision-making, and independent functioning, facilitating rest.
However, forex robots bring limitations. They demand accurate configuration which could be daunting.
Furthermore, robots might struggle with volatile markets and depend on preset parameters, possibly causing missed opportunities or losses if incorrectly managed.
